Paula Radcliffe MBE, the former Women’s Marathon World Record holder, will be joining the 10KM run of the Al Mouj Muscat Marathon 2020! During a glittering career, this legendary runner took the title in Chicago (2002) and was three-time winner of both the London (2002, 2003, 2005) and New York (2004, 2007, 2008) Marathons. Having retired from competitive running in 2015, Paula retained her status as the fastest female marathoner of all time for sixteen years; her World Record of 2:15:25, set in 2003, remained unbeaten until 2019.

Try to drink lots of water in the 3 days before the race and cut down on tea and coffee (both of which tend to dehydrate).

Take an easy jog to loosen your legs and to prepare yourself mentally.

Avoid unusual foods. Stick to what you have been eating during training to avoid any stomach issues that can come with new or unfamiliar foods.

Ensure you collect your race pack before the race day. You will require your confirmation e-mail with QR code and a photo ID. Race pack collection is at Oman Sail Headquarters at Al Mouj, Muscat on February 19th and 20th 2020, from 12.00pm - 9.00pm each day.

1. Pace yourself to complete the race within your comfortable heart rate zone and at a speed that you can maintain all the way round.

2. Once you’re off, don’t spend the first km trying to weave your way through the crowd of runners in front of you. You use up a lot of energy unnecessarily. Go at the same pace as the others, using the first mile as a warm up. The course will thin out in time, and you’ll have plenty of time to get back on your target pace.

1. Wake up early and have your breakfast 2-3 hours prior to your scheduled start time. This is to ensure that your food is properly digested before the race.

2. Arrive at the race venue early to warm up with our fitness partners - see schedule on page 44. Do some final dynamic exercises to promote muscle stretch, whilst keeping blood flowing to the muscles. Some good examples include: Leg Swings, Side Swings, Butt Kicks and Knee Lifts.

3. Stay calm and visualise your race.

4. Visit the toilet in the race village before going to the start line.

5. Use petroleum jelly to prevent chafing in areas like inner thighs, under arms and even nipples.

6. Get to the correct start position according to your pace so that you will not block other runners.

Your intensity

Your fuel

Your Hydration

There are three key things you need to be thinking about when you are running:

Start at a slower pace and aim to build your way into the run, ending with a strong finish. The tendency in longer runs is to start too fast and pay for it later in the race, so exercise control and work your way into the challenge. Start the run at a pace that you could maintain throughout the entire distance.

Ensure you are consistently taking in your calories to replace what you are burning. Depending on weight, experience etc. you should look to be consuming gel every 30-45min or so. GU Energy gels will be available at resfreshment points on the route. You may bring your own gels to use while running, if this is your preference..

By the time you feel thirsty, it is TOO LATE. Drink before you get thirsty. Sip regularly on water or electrolyte drinks throughout the run. Never take electrolyte drinks and gels at the same time. When the going gets tough, focus on what you can control. Think about your technique and your breathing.

Race Pacers

Pacing assistance will be offered to runners competing in the marathon, half marathon and 10KM races to obtain their personal best times. This is achieved by providing a pacing ‘bus’ to a number of target times. All runners are welcome to compete alongside experienced pacers from Muscat Road Runners, who will guide them to completing their races in accordance with the official finish time marked on their flags.

Pacers will run 20 to 50 seconds slower during the first half of their races and then slightly faster in the second half, to enable them to ‘pull’ runners on board their ‘bus’ for the final couple of kilometres.

Working to improve the lives of the Sultanate’s citizens who are currently sufferers, the Oman Diabetes Association also helps to avert the onset of type 2 Diabetes by spreading awareness in the local community.

The Environment Society of Oman is the first and only environmental NGO in Oman. It aims to protect Oman’s natural heritage and influence environmentally sustainable behaviour through education, awareness and conservation.
